Oh, you mean the AbstractWorkflow class? Why? What would this gain you? I think it would add the potential for a LOT of bad things (eg, what if a function calls an action which calls the function?) If you're needing this, then I think you likely have a pretty bad design...It IS possible via BasicWorkflow, but highly discouraged.
